Transaction 80f5e73f02f8dae954f698f29e272ee8fcc1b802a39243ec8ffd39a170bccf95

1 Input
2 Outputs
  • 80f5e73f02f8dae954f698f29e272ee8fcc1b802a39243ec8ffd39a170bccf95:0
  • value  425000
    address  35Eab9VMbZxba2iEVqCHpuGLJYbyYC3kYY
  • 80f5e73f02f8dae954f698f29e272ee8fcc1b802a39243ec8ffd39a170bccf95:1
  • value  116542683
    address  3QSqhTkGLD5E4rkmHMTPRgaZc37eap5aff